ROLE SUMMARY RV Tech — the Rivian and Volkswagen Group joint venture — builds the electrical and electronic foundation of a software-defined vehicle platform used by both partner OEMs. Our Electrical Systems Hardware Engineering group owns the vehicle's electrical system architecture and domain definition. As a Staff engineer, you own the architecture and integration of several electrical domains on US-based programs, covering both electrical system definition and low-voltage power distribution. RESPONSIBILITIES - Own the electrical architecture for your assigned domains: low- and high-voltage (LV/HV) power distribution, harness strategy, and electrical interface definitions - Define zonal topology inputs — zonal ECU count and placement — and allocate devices and device I/O to zonal controllers - Define LV power architecture: supply strategy across batteries, DC-DC converters, and eFuses; bus management, power modes, and fault handling - Develop mission profiles and accessory power requirements, including load budgets and quiescent current targets - Decompose vehicle- and system-level specifications into subsystem, component, and zonal interface requirements with full traceability - Develop and negotiate requirements with component suppliers and internal component owners - Define hardware-driven software requirements for embedded software teams - Review schematics for conformance to the defined architecture - Develop and execute validation plans across unit, software-in-the-loop (SIL), hardware-in-the-loop (HIL), and vehicle-level testing - Lead root cause analysis and resolution of electrical issues through development and validation - Evaluate and recommend next-generation technologies, and support the R&D needed to mature them - Align electrical system boundaries with vehicle systems and software teams, and confirm designs scale across both Rivian and Volkswagen Group programs QUALIFICATIONS Minimum Qualifications: - BS in Electrical Engineering, Computer Engineering, or a related field - ~8+ years in electrical systems engineering on automotive or comparable complex embedded products - Ownership of an electrical system or domain through a full development cycle - Expertise in LV/HV power systems, electrical distribution, and wiring harness design - Requirements decomposition, interface definition, and validation coverage - Experience developing and negotiating technical requirements with component suppliers - Working knowledge of vehicle networks (CAN, CAN-FD, LIN, Automotive Ethernet) - Familiarity with ISO 26262 functional safety as applied to electrical systems Preferred Qualifications - Zonal or centralized E/E architecture experience on a production program - eFuse or solid-state power distribution, DC-DC converter sizing, or 12V/48V bus design - Power mode and sleep/wake state machine specification - Circuit simulation for load, transient, and fault analysis (SPICE, Saber, or equivalent) - Electrical design tooling - MS in Electrical Engineering or a related field TOTAL REWARDS We build the exceptional — and we believe the people doing that work should be rewarded accordingly.
